How are the GreekKeys Unicode inputs of GreekKeys 2008 different from those of the 2005 version?

0

One error in the 2005 inputs has been corrected in 2008 (for iota with macron and circumflex), and the input files have been normalized so that the deadkeys are correctly indicated in the Keyboard Viewer palette. Return to top of FAQ.
